如何禁用button按钮(一招轻松搞定:禁用button按钮)
摘要:本文将介绍一种方便快捷的方式来禁用button按钮,这个技巧对于Web开发人员和网页设计师来说非常有用。通过这种技巧,用户可以轻松地实现在网页中禁用按钮的效果,从而提高网页的使用体验。
一、背景介绍
在Web开发和网页设计中,按钮是一个经常被使用的元素。但是,在某些情况下,可能需要禁用某个按钮,比如当某个表单没有正确填写时,需要禁用提交按钮。通常的做法是通过JavaScript来实现这个功能,但是这种方式比较麻烦,需要编写大量的代码,而且可能会带来兼容性问题。因此,本文将介绍一种更加简单、快捷的方法来禁用按钮。
二、方法介绍
本文介绍的这种方法非常简单,只需要在HTML中使用button元素的disabled属性即可。disabled属性是一个布尔类型的属性,如果将它设置为true,那么按钮就会被禁用。具体的代码如下所示:
在这个示例中,我们简单地在button元素中添加了disabled属性,并将其设置为true。这个属性会直接禁用按钮,使得用户无法点击它。
值得注意的是,在现代浏览器中,禁用按钮后会导致按钮呈现灰色,同时无法响应用户的点击事件。但是,在一些老的浏览器中,禁用按钮并不会导致按钮变灰,用户仍然可以点击它,只是没有任何反应。因此,在实际应用中,需要注意这个问题,并进行兼容性测试。
三、应用场景
禁用按钮的应用场景非常广泛,比如说:
1. 表单验证:在用户填写表单时,如果某些内容没有填写完成或填写错误,可以禁用提交按钮,防止用户提交不完整或者错误的表单。
2. 避免重复提交:当用户点击提交按钮后,可以禁用按钮,避免用户多次点击提交,重复提交表单。
3. 加载中效果:当用户点击某些按钮后,可以禁用按钮,并在按钮上显示“加载中”的效果,让用户知道正在进行操作,避免用户的重复点击。
以上只是几个比较典型的应用场景,实际上,禁用按钮的方法还有很多其他的应用。
四、注意事项
在使用禁用按钮的方法时,需要注意一些细节问题。比如说:
1. 兼容性问题:禁用按钮的效果在不同的浏览器中可能会有所不同,需要进行兼容性测试。
2. 使用场景:禁用按钮只在部分场景下才适用,不是万能的,需要根据具体的场景进行选择。
3. 用户体验:在禁用按钮的同时,应该给出一定的提示,让用户知道为什么按钮被禁用了,避免用户的困惑。
四、总结
本文介绍了一种禁用button按钮的方法,这个方法非常简单、快捷,适用于Web开发人员和网页设计师。通过这种方法,用户可以在不编写复杂的JavaScript代码的情况下轻松地实现禁用按钮的效果。当然,使用这个方法需要注意一些细节问题,比如兼容性、使用场景和用户体验等方面。
如发现本站有涉嫌抄袭侵权/违法违规等内容,请<举报!一经查实,本站将立刻删除。